Heart-failure deaths surging after a decade of decline - UW …

(2 days ago) WebA decade of progressively fewer heart failure deaths in the United States reversed course in 2012. By 2021, heart-failure deaths had rebounded so sharply that they eclipsed the volume of those deaths seen in 1999. Ethnic minority patients with heart failure at higher risk of death

(8 days ago) WebThe risk of death in ethnic minority heart failure patients was calculated to be 36% higher than that of White patients after an average of 17 months. The study looked at data from more than 16,700 patients. The research also showed that the disparity was greater if patients also had atrial fibrillation. When the researchers looked at people
